CI note: The Fabrikant test-data factory library intermittently fails its seed-determinism check when runners pick up a stale cache layer. Clearing the cache and pinning the factory version resolves it. No fixture data leaves the sandboxed runner at any point. The last clean run of the determinism suite is recorded under the token below.

trace token, kaduf-kadup: htk14_d0223cc3c18e70

Release checklist — Webhook retry semantics

Verify that Hollowgate webhook delivery retries follow the new policy: exponential backoff, five attempts max, and a dead-letter queue entry after final failure. Confirm duplicate-suppression headers are set so partners can dedupe safely. Run the replay suite against staging and make sure no endpoint sees more than one successful delivery. Record results against the build shown below.

build token for yajof-bajof: htk31_506ff1188f74596b5bb2eec94edc43c

Minutes — Management Meeting, Halbrook Office

Present: Dorn, Vessey, Okani, Trell.

Agenda: capital budget request for the Merrow facility upgrade.

Vessey presented costings; contingency raised to 12%. Okani flagged scheduling risk against the Yarrow rollout. Dorn confirmed funding is available without external borrowing. Motion to recommend approval to the board carried unanimously. Submission due before the next board sitting. One item was discussed in closed session and is recorded only for board eyes in the confidential note below.

board note of kageg-bahof: The renewal with Holwynax Holdings closes at $2 million a year, 5 percent below the last contract. Project Ulaath slips by two quarters because of the supplier delay.